What might cause a starter motor to spin but not crank or spin the engine?

So, if you suspect that the starter motor may be causing your vehicle to not start, there are several potential issues to consider. Firstly, the internal windings of the starter motor could have a fault which means it lacks sufficient torque to crank the engine. Alternatively, bad brushes in the starter or other electrical faults can cause similar problems. Finally, mechanical issues such as worn-out bearings inside the starter or teeth no longer meshing with the ring gear can also lead to difficulties starting up your car. What are the three possible cranking system faults?

Some car engines have a cranking system that can be used for troubleshooting when the engine does not start. Depending on the symptoms, car owners can divide their problem into three distinct categories: Click – No-Crank (solenoid clicks but starter does not crank), No-Click – No-Crank (solenoid doesn't click and starter does not crank) or Slow Crank (starter cranks, but engine RPM is slow to start vehicle). The first step in troubleshooting is to identify which of these three issues is occurring. If there is a clicking sound, then it indicates that the solenoid has been activated and the issue lies in either with the battery connection or low voltage within the system. When no sound comes from the solenoid at all, it could mean an issue with either the wiring connections or a component failure within its circuitry. Lastly, if there's a slow crank occurring this could point towards an issue with either your battery having inadequate power storage capabilities or other parts such as damaged spark plugs or worn out belts causing insufficient energy to activate your engine.

What would cause the engine to not continue to run after start up?

For many car owners, the experience of turning their key in the ignition and having their engine stop immediately upon starting can be a frustrating one. After all, it's disheartening to find that your engine won't stay running even after you've just gotten it going. Fortunately, this sort of problem is usually quite easy to diagnose and fix. Generally speaking, if your engine stops as soon as you let the key return from the Start to the Run position then it usually points towards either a clogged fuel filter or an ignition switch with worn or burned contacts. To help identify which of these two issues is causing your problems you'll need to start by checking out your fuel filter; if it looks dirty or clogged up then a replacement will likely do the trick. On the other hand, if it appears clean then there may be something wrong with your ignition switch itself - either needing adjustment or simply being in need of a replacement due to its internal components being worn down over time.
